Job Description

ManTech seeks a motivated, career- and customer-oriented Voice Over Internet Protocol (VOIP) Technician to join our team in Annapolis Junction, MD.
In this role, you will serve as the VOIP SME, supporting Cisco Unified Call Managers across a global footprint and managing POTS lines, including e911 services in support of the Government customer.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Provide broad telephony support, including administrator-level configurations and in-depth technical solutions over secure and nonsecure networks

  • Serve as the SME for engineers, surveyors, installers, and project managers to develop and implement end-to-end solutions across various vendor products

  • Manage multiple communication projects to support critical response efforts and streamline services for analog, digital, and video requirements

  • Administer voicemail servers, call managers, and emergency responders involving T1, fiber, Ethernet, multiplexing, copper wrap, and cellular servicing

  • Configure and troubleshoot multi-vendor hardware and software systems to support complex defense operations

  • Engage in the escalation process and provide timely status updates to agency management and internal stakeholders

  • Support clients across multi-level service platforms by executing in-depth resolutions for real-time incidents and service requests

  • Provide support for TCP/IP network protocols, including TCP, Session Initiation Protocol (SIP), Session Description Protocol (SDP), and VoIP codecs

  • Integrate VOIP systems through planning, design, installation, maintenance, and lifecycle coordination

  • Monitor, tune, and support telephone systems and network infrastructure to ensure stability, reliability, and efficiency

  • Identify and assess technical requirements, including re-architecting network segments to support growth and new technologies

  • Support lien mitigation efforts to maintain a compliant System Security Plan and network security posture

  • Communicate effectively with diverse technical and non-technical audiences, including customers, partners, and staff

  • Travel approximately 10–20% in support of service requirements; opportunities may include CONUS and OCONUS travel for AVMM support (non-hostile areas only)
